A Maintenance Assistant Labourer is required to support and assist the Building Maintenance Technicians by providing efficient general labouring duties in the repair, maintenance and improvement of domestic, industrial and public buildings.
Key responsibilities:
- Assist Building Maintenance Technicians in the execution of building maintenance work through the provision of efficient general labouring duties.
- Assist and support the Building Maintenance Technicians to achieve acceptable industry standards in all building works completed and ensure repairs and maintenance are undertaken within agreed timescales and to customers’ satisfaction.
- Ensure the efficient use of the department’s resources, materials and plant when undertaking general labouring duties.
- Maintain the required level of performance in respect of productive output, attendance, job completion deadlines, kept appointments and customer satisfaction to ensure value for money and quality of outputs to all service stakeholders.
- Ensure that all work undertaken is completed in a considerate manner and to a satisfactory standard in accordance with relevant legislation.
- Daily completion of job tickets and timesheets, describing works undertaken in sufficient detail to assist in the calculation of performance and invoicing data.
- Action the instructions and requirements of the Building Maintenance Technicians.
- Accurately record work undertaken via the Maintenance Schedule of Rates, actual working time, materials and plant used in the execution of selected building maintenance work.
- Ensure the safe use and storage of plant and materials issued to the post holder in the course of their duties.
- Attend and take part in training initiatives specific to the role and the requirements of the service.
- Adhere to Health and Safety legislation and relevant Council policies and procedures and take reasonable care for the health and safety of yourself and other persons who may be adversely affected by your acts or omissions.

Other “Essential Requirements” – Please check to ensure that your CV addresses the following items:
Qualifications:
- Good numeracy and literacy skills.
- Relevant Health & Safety Certification: e.g. manual handling, COSHH, working at heights desirable.
Experience & Knowledge:
- Building/Construction training and/or experience in the building/construction industry desirable.
- Experience within a repairs and maintenance environment desirable.
- Minimum of 12 months recent experience in a similar role or context and ideally within a public sector organisation.
Skills & Abilities:
- Capable of working within a team environment.
- Ability to communicate effectively in verbal and written form.
- Ability to interpret and action work instructions.
- Be able to maintain minimum standards identified by maintenance technicians, foreman or line manager.
- Flexible in approach to work duties.
- Self motivated and flexible in approach to working hours during the normal working week and job skills.
- Punctual, reliable and ability to meet prioritised work.
- A customer focused attitude.
- Availability and willingness to work during an emergency situation if required.
